Beware Of Bears

"They're the most dangerous type of bear, probably because food is scarce where they live so they will actively attack humans for food unlike most other bears."

"The super general advice is:"

  • "Black bears:. Make yourself seem as big and threatening as possible while slowly getting away. Shows of aggression can scare them off. Attacks are rare but black bears may attack to kill."
  • "Brown bears: Make yourself seem as nonthreatening as possible while slowly getting away. They're territorial so shows of aggression will provoke them but they may ignore you if you are clearly no threat. Attacks are rare, but Brown bears are not usually attacking to kill, more to scare you off, so people do survive maulings, and many encounters have the bear just walk on by."
  • "White bears: No real advice. If you cannot get inside a bearproof structure before a polar bear gets to you, it will kill you."

"'If it's black: attack. If it's brown: lay down. If it's white: goodnight.' Is the version I'm used to."

– SteamboatMcGee
